Hunter places second, Lions take eighth

Aaron Hunter earned a trip to the podium

PETERSBURG, Va. (April 23, 2011) — Aaron Hunter (Sharon Hill, PA/Academy Park) recorded Lincoln's top finish at the Central Intercollegiate Athletic Association Championships, a second-place effort in the long jump.

He pounced a season-best 7.42 meters, trailing just Orlando Duffus of Saint Augustine's College by two hundredths of a meter. Hunter's excitement was tempered. While he was thrilled to receive a medal and acquire eight of Lincoln's 24 points, he was disappointed to have his streak broken. He had won three long jump titles in a row entering the conference championships.

Hunter also earned an additional five points by placing fourth in the triple jump by registering a distance of 46 feet, 3.25 inches.

Overall, the Lions placed eighth of 10. Saint Augustine's College took the crown with 176.50 points while Johnson C. Smith (119) and Winston-Salem State (106) rounded out the top three.

Lincoln's 4x100 team of Kevin Morgan (Providence, R.I./Hope HS), Andre Wilkinson (St. Michael's, Barbados/William Grady (NY)), Asaad Monroe (Wilmington, DE/Delcastle Technical HS) and Diedre McLeod also placed fourth, running a 42.61lap for an additional five points. The group also qualified for the IC4A championships.

In the 400-meter hurdles, Tarem Cannonier (Whiteplains, N.Y./Woodlands HS) placed fifth, crossing in 54.26 for four team points.

Vincent Thomas (Columbia, PA/Columbia, PA) advanced to the finals in the 800 meters and placed eighth for one team point. He ran a solid race of 1:58.51

Cannonier, Thomas, Hunter and Diedre McLeod also earned a point for placing eighth in the 4x400-meter relay in a time of 3:21.56.
